How Color Your Way to Happiness Works—A Clear, Neutral Look

Color therapy isn’t new, but digital tools make it widely accessible. Color by number websites break the process into digestible steps: users select a theme—often serene landscapes, nature scenes, or seasonal motifs—then apply predefined colors using numbered sections. No artistic skill required—just focus on the visual harmony as color fills the image step by step. The result is spontaneous self-expression embedded in a familiar, comforting pattern.

Common Questions About Color Your Way to Happiness—Get Free Color by Number Websites Free Today!

How consistent does the color selection need to be?
Color by number tools rely on fixed palettes—colors are pre-mapped and intentional. Straying from the numbers may disrupt the intended effect, but overall guidance supports personal input within structured boundaries.

Are the results printed-friendly or digital only?
Most sites offer downloadable versions for printing. Colorings become physical artifacts—posters, note cards, or floor plans—blending digital fun with tangible pride.

Can this activity improve mental well-being?
While not a therapy substitute, studies suggest structured coloring supports relaxation, improves focus, and reduces short-term anxiety. Users report increased calm and moments of mindful pause.
